BBC NEWS | Technology | ‘Blog’ picked as word of the year

02Dec04

“Merriam-Webster said ‘blog’ headed the list of most looked-up terms on its site during the last twelve months. During 2004 blogs, or web logs, have become hugely popular and some have started to influence mainstream media. Other words on the Merriam-Webster list were associated with major news events such as the US presidential election or natural disasters that hit the US. Merriam-Webster defines a blog as: ‘a Web site that contains an online personal journal with reflections, comments and often hyperlinks’. ”

“According to the Pew Internet & American Life project, a blog is created every 5.8 seconds, and blog analysis firm Technorati estimates that the number of blogs in existence now exceeds 4.8 million.”
